The individual accused of provoking a riot similar to the infamous Cronulla unrest, following the Bondi Beach tragedy, has been refused bail.

Ryder Shaw, a 20-year-old barber from Queensland, faced the court on charges linked to allegedly attempting to incite chaos.

Appearing in court attired in a grey t-shirt, Shaw (pictured below) sat with his gaze lowered and hands resting in his lap, while his attorney, Brian Quinn, sought bail on his behalf this Monday.

Prosecutor Felicia Lay opposed the bail request, citing concerns about the potential for Shaw to reoffend and emphasizing the gravity of the accusations against him.

“The posts included a specific date and location, suggesting they were not merely incendiary but actively incited participation,” Lay argued.

According to Ms. Lay, police documents indicate Shaw was identified as one of the event’s organizers.

The court heard Shaw has been working part-time as a barber on the Sunshine Coast, where he lives with his partner.

He allegedly posted the event details online while in Queensland, before being arrested during a visit to family on the NSW coast, the court heard.

The court heard Shaw allegedly posted on TikTok urging people to attend Cronulla for a ‘Middle Eastern bashing day’.

Mr Quinn said the post quickly went viral, bringing his client to the attention of police.

Mr Quinn argued his client had no prior record, suggesting bail conditions such as residing at one of two Central Coast addresses, being barred from Sydney, reporting to police twice a week and avoiding social media.

However, Magistrate Margaret Quinn said the allegations were very serious and could possibly result in jail time if proven.

‘I don’t know if that young man who [allegedly] killed all those people in Bondi had a record either,’ she said.

‘Inciting people to violence because of race or religion is repulsive.

‘That young man [Shaw] should realise that the person who saved people [at the Bondi shooting] was a Muslim.

‘This young man seems to be a Muslim hater. That is what his text suggests.’

Magistrate Quinn said the alleged offending was made even more serious by the fact ‘feelings are running high at the moment’ and the event details were specified.

‘There is a date involved and a place. They are not just a random declaration to kill or do something to others. It actually sets down a date and place,’ she said.

Magistrate Quinn denied Shaw bail, arguing there was an unacceptable risk of endangering others in the community.

He is next due before court on February 26 next year.
